Al-tawilah: The Asma Educational Complex for Girls in Bayt Qutainah, Bani Al-Khayyat isolate, Al-Tawilah District, Al-Mahwit Governorate, organized a cultural event today to celebrate the anniversary of the noble Prophet's birth (may the best prayers and purest peace be upon him and his family).
According to Yemen News Agency, the event's speeches highlighted the significance of commemorating the Mawlid al-Nabawi, encouraging attendees to draw lessons from the biography of the Greatest Messenger Muhammad (PBUH) and to implement his values and principles in daily life. The speeches emphasized the Yemeni people's deep affection for the Prophet (PBUH) and the importance of embedding Quranic culture and prophetic values in students.
The event was followed by the opening of a photo exhibition showcasing panels and pictures depicting various aspects of the prophetic biography, the stages of the Prophet's life (PBUH), and the guiding values of mercy and morals inherent in the Muhammadan message.
In addition, students from the Al-Wahda Educational Complex, Al-Falah School, and Fursan Al-Aqsa Private School in Al-Tawilah city organized a march to celebrate the Mawlid al-Nabawi. The march began at the Al-Wahda Educational Complex in the east of Al-Tawilah city and concluded at the Sheikh Station in the west. The event saw participation from Abdullah Saad, head of the Education Sector in the district, along with several department heads, school principals, and teachers.
Participants in the march expressed their joy and delight through songs and slogans, underscoring the importance of commemorating the Mawlid al-Nabawi in a manner that honors the occasion's greatness and the Prophet's esteemed status. They emphasized the need to enhance awareness of the Prophet's biography, path, values, and morals.
